Raspberry pi 3b specs12/31/2022 ![]() ![]() This frequency is required for the synchronization of all internal functions. Dual-core Arm Cortex-M0+ processor is added to the board that comes with flexible clock frequency up to 133 MHz.on-board Switched Mode Power Supply (SMPS), driving an LED, power control, and sensing the system voltages. While four RP2040 IO are employed for internal functions i.e. Mostly the RP2040 microcontroller pins are taken to the user IO pins on the right and left edge of the module.Moreover, RP2040 is added to the board that is considered as the first in-house microcontroller introduced by Raspberry Pi. This tiny board incorporates 26 GPIO pins that you can configure either as an input or as output.At the time of writing this article, you can get this device in only $4 which is a cost-effective solution to your electronic needs. Pico is the most economical board among other Raspberry Pi modules.Unlike other Raspberry Pi modules, this board is not a full computer. Raspberry Pi Pico is a microcontroller board (released on ) mainly developed for robotics and embedded applications.I suggest you buckle up as I’ll explain Raspberry Pi Pico in detail. It is not a computer but a microcontroller board. This is different from other single-board computers that fall under the Raspberry Pi series. This unit is similar to Arduino Nano and is called a microcontroller board that incorporates a powerful RP2040 chip. King tongue play online12/31/2022 ![]() “If the stammer had been inauthentic, we would have had no film,” Firth told me on a recent visit to New York to publicize the film. He drew on these experiences to build a rich, believable portrait of Bertie’s speech impediment and Logue’s unconventional approach to helping him overcome it. They don’t, as far as I’m concerned, cure the stutter.” Seidler knows whereof he speaks, because he himself grew up with a stutter. “These mechanical techniques,” Seidler explained to me in a recent interview, “are incredibly useful once you’ve overcome your stutter internally. The historian Denis Judd, in his 1982 biography of George VI, reported that Logue’s vocal exercises included the sentences “Let’s go gathering healthy heather with the gay brigade of grand dragoons” and “She sifted seven thick-stalked thistles through a strong thick sieve.” As it happens, variants of the “thistle sifter” tongue twister date back to 1831, when American journals reported that this “unutterably curious sentence is frequently used in schools for the correction of stammering.” When David Seidler began working on the screenplay for “The King’s Speech,” the tongue twisters were one of the few publicly known details about the real-life Logue’s techniques in working with Bertie. ![]() After the abdication of his brother, Edward VIII, in 1936 opens the throne to Bertie, the therapy has geopolitical consequences, permitting the new king to address the nation in live radio broadcasts on the brink of World War II. ![]() Logue prescribes a regimen of vocal calisthenics, tongue twisters among them, to improve the mechanics of Bertie’s speech. ![]() But “Bertie,” as Firth’s character is known to his family, has much graver concerns: he is crippled by a stammer that makes public speaking a devilish chore. Similarly, the voice coach in “Singin’ in the Rain” tries to steer the silent-film star Lina Lamont away from a grating New York accent inappropriate for the talkies. Henry Higgins in “My Fair Lady” (and its predecessor, “Pygmalion”) trains the flower girl Eliza Doolittle to lose her Cockney diphthongs. “My Fair Lady” had “The rain in Spain stays mainly in the plain.” “Singin’ in the Rain” had “Moses supposes his toeses are roses.” To cinema’s pantheon of tricky diction, we can now add, “I have a sieve full of sifted thistles and a sieve full of unsifted thistles, because I am a thistle sifter.” Audiences for “The King’s Speech” can hear Colin Firth as Prince Albert, Duke of York (later King George VI), practice this tongue twister as part of the speech therapy conducted by Lionel Logue, played by Geoffrey Rush. ![]()
